Fungi resistant asphalt and asphalt sheet materials

Abstract
A fungi resistant asphalt is combined with a base sheet to form a fungi resistant asphalt containing sheet material. Typically, the base sheet is a fibrous base sheet that, by itself, may or may not be fungi resistant. The fungi resistant asphalt is at least partially absorbed by the base sheet to form the fungi resistant asphalt containing sheet material and typically forms one or both major surfaces of the fungi resistant asphalt containing sheet material.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1 . A fungi resistant asphalt, comprising:
asphalt; and a fungi growth-inhibiting agent in the asphalt in amounts that result in a fungi resistant asphalt having more fungi growth resistance than the asphalt without the fungi growth-inhibiting agent.
2 . The fungi resistant asphalt according to claim 1 , wherein:
the fungi resistant asphalt tested in accordance with ASTM Test Designation C 1338-00 is fungi growth resistant.
3 . The fungi resistant asphalt according to claim 1 , wherein:
the fungi resistant asphalt tested in accordance with ASTM Test Designation C 1338-00 is fungi growth resistant with no observable fungi growth.
4 . The fungi resistant asphalt according to claim 1 , wherein:
the asphalt without the fungi growth-inhibiting agent is not fungi growth resistant; and the fungi resistant asphalt tested in accordance with ASTM Test Designation D 2020-92 is fungus resistant.
5 . The fungi resistant asphalt according to claim 1 , wherein:
the asphalt without the fungi growth-inhibiting agent is not fungi growth resistant; and the fungi resistant asphalt tested in accordance with ASTM Test Designation G 21-96 has a rating of 1 or less.
6 . The fungi resistant asphalt according to claim 1 , wherein:
the fungi growth-inhibiting agent comprises 2-(4-Thiazolyl) Benzimidazole.
7 . The fungi resistant asphalt according to claim 6 , wherein:
the fungi resistant asphalt contains between 200 and 2000 ppm 2-(4-Thiazolyl) Benzimidazole.
8 . The fungi resistant asphalt according to claim 6 , wherein:
the fungi resistant asphalt contains between 300 and 700 ppm 2-(4-Thiazolyi) Benzimidazole.
